All living organisms need energy to survive. This energy comes from the foods that they eat. However, in order to meet the demands of energy required throughout the day the body of the organism must store its energy for use later on. Lipids and carbohydrates are the compounds used in these organisms to store energy.

Carbohydrates are organic compounds made from sugars.Proteins are organic compounds made from amino acids.Fats are organic compounds of the class known as esters and made form the alcohol glycerol and three fatty acid chains.
The body is made mostly of organic compounds. The only abundant inorganic compound is water.

Adenoside triphosphate (ATP) is the provider of energy to all cells in your body. Many other biomolecules are used as a store of energy like fats, and carbohydrates like glycogen, but ultimately all energy is provided to the cell in a usable form by the ATP molecule.· Carbohydrates, Protein, Lipids, Nucleic acid.
The element of carbon (C) enters the human body through our intake of food. In turn the body uses these organic compounds for creating energy, repair and growth.
By inorganic, we're talking about compounds without carbon. Your body is capable of metabolizing four general compounds for energy, carbohydrates, fats, protein and alcohol. All of these compounds are organic. Inorganic nutrients cannot be metabolized for energy and play some other role in the body, so they cannot be stored as fat.
